Transaction 70996c64ba754ee516b9472bdc14131fed58fc3e5d3bc2f95cd51ed4cdb6cbe9
1 Input
2 Outputs
- 70996c64ba754ee516b9472bdc14131fed58fc3e5d3bc2f95cd51ed4cdb6cbe9:0
- 70996c64ba754ee516b9472bdc14131fed58fc3e5d3bc2f95cd51ed4cdb6cbe9:1
value 89953
address 1KLhafNQpbPpKz7C7vGthK4wt5ptVR9rWT
value 106000
address 3FGkZMqWUY8EkiWaXxMWgEAWXX3MqLpQkP